首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

postgresql中的对象数组

PostgreSQL中的对象数组是一种数据类型,它允许在单个数据库字段中存储多个值。该数组可以包含多种数据类型的元素,例如整数、字符串、日期等。下面是有关postgresql中的对象数组的详细信息:

概念: 对象数组是一种可变长度的、有序的集合,它允许在一个字段中存储多个值。每个值都有一个唯一的索引,可以通过索引访问数组中的元素。

分类: 对象数组可以分为一维数组和多维数组。一维数组只包含一个维度,而多维数组则包含多个维度。

优势:

  1. 灵活性:对象数组提供了一种灵活的数据结构,可以用于存储和处理多个值。
  2. 简化数据模型:通过将相关数据存储在一个字段中,对象数组可以简化数据模型,减少表之间的关联关系。
  3. 查询效率:使用对象数组可以提高查询效率,尤其是在处理需要同时操作多个值的场景下。

应用场景: 对象数组在很多场景下都能够提供便利,例如:

  1. 商品属性:可以将商品的多个属性(如尺寸、颜色、价格等)存储在一个数组字段中。
  2. 用户兴趣:可以将用户的多个兴趣爱好存储在一个数组字段中。
  3. 日程安排:可以将每天的多个日程事件存储在一个数组字段中。

推荐的腾讯云相关产品: 腾讯云提供了多个与数据库相关的产品,以下是其中两个产品的介绍:

  1. 云数据库 PostgreSQL: 腾讯云的云数据库 PostgreSQL 是一种完全托管的 PostgreSQL 数据库服务,它提供了高可用、高性能的数据库解决方案。您可以使用云数据库 PostgreSQL 来存储和处理对象数组以及其他数据类型。

产品介绍链接地址:https://cloud.tencent.com/product/postgres

  1. 云原生数据库 TDSQL: 腾讯云的云原生数据库 TDSQL 是一种全球分布式的云原生数据库服务,它基于 PostgreSQL 构建,提供了高性能、弹性扩展、全球部署等特性。您可以使用 TDSQL 存储和处理对象数组以及其他数据类型。

产品介绍链接地址:https://cloud.tencent.com/product/tdsql

请注意,以上推荐的产品链接仅供参考,具体选择适合的产品应根据实际需求进行评估和决策。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

1分6秒

【赵渝强老师】PostgreSQL中的数据库对象

1分21秒

【赵渝强老师】PostgreSQL的模式

6分30秒

【剑指Offer】3. 数组中重复的数字

24.3K
4分31秒

【赵渝强老师】PostgreSQL的体系架构

1分7秒

【赵渝强老师】PostgreSQL的表空间

52秒

【赵渝强老师】PostgreSQL的控制文件

1分10秒

【赵渝强老师】PostgreSQL的参数文件

13分19秒

day07_数组/19-尚硅谷-Java语言基础-数组中的常见异常

13分19秒

day07_数组/19-尚硅谷-Java语言基础-数组中的常见异常

13分19秒

day07_数组/19-尚硅谷-Java语言基础-数组中的常见异常

2分27秒

解决 requests 库中的字节对象问题

1分41秒

【赵渝强老师】PostgreSQL的逻辑存储结构

领券